0:51.5 | Wow, what a powerful clip. I mean, just a powerful speech. Happy MLK Day, a day in the |
0:57.6 | state dedicated to the memory of the life and the cause of one of America's great leaders |
1:02.2 | towards justice and equality for all Americans. His influence, of course, has spread far beyond |
1:08.6 | America too. Behind a microphone and standing in front of a crowd, Martin Luther King Jr.'s |
1:14.3 | gifts came alive. He stirred millions with his voice, inspiring through eloquent words |
1:20.6 | and living illustrations. All of those gifts are on display in his iconic. I have a dream |
1:26.8 | speech in front of the Lincoln Memorial in DC on August 28, 1963. Pastor John, I know |
1:32.6 | you have been thinking a lot about King, King the preacher, particularly. I'd love for |
1:37.0 | you to share with us on this MLK Day, some of your thoughts of what's on your mind. |
1:42.4 | Tony, I'm teaching a class on preaching, which I love doing right now. And as I've been |
1:48.3 | pondering whom these young man should listen to for models of preaching, it struck me |
1:54.9 | that Martin Luther King Jr. and Billy Graham are probably the two most powerful preachers |
2:05.3 | of the second half of the 20th century. And maybe we could say the whole 20th century. Billy |
2:11.6 | Graham was riveting to listen to with a kind of directness and decisiveness and simplicity |
2:19.8 | and authority that could hold 20th century people from 1949 to 2009 spellbound for 45 minutes |
2:28.4 | in crowds of 50,000 or up to a million in Seoul, Korea. Absolutely incredible what force |
